#98d60c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#98d60c is composed of 59.6% red, 83.9%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29% cyan, 0% magenta, 94.4%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 78.4 degrees, a saturation of 89.4% and a lightness of 44.3%. #98d60c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ff18 with #31ad00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c00.

● #98d60c color description : Strong green.
#98d60c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#98d60c has RGB values of R:152, G:214, B:12 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0, Y:0.94,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 10016268.
